Treadwell&Rdlo <br /> groundwater was discharged into the sanitary sewer at 420 North Madison Street by Evans <br /> Brothers Construction Laboratory analytical reports for the groundwater samples are included <br /> in Appendix B <br /> 1 4.5 <br /> Soil and Groundwater Sampling and Analyses <br /> ' Following the removal at the groundwater cited in Section 4 4, on 20 Apnl 2005, one soil <br /> confirmation sample, CPT-EXC-25, was collected from the bottom of the excavation at 25 bgs <br /> (Figure 2) One groundwater sample, CPT-EXC-GW, was also collected from water in the <br /> bottom of the excavation Both samples were analyzed for TPHg and BTEX compounds by EPA <br /> ' Methods 8015M and 8020 respectively (Tables 1 and 2) In soil confirmation sample CPT-EXC- <br /> 25, TPHg, BTEX, and MTBE were not detected above laboratory reporting limits TPHd was <br /> ' detected at 12 mg/kg In groundwater sample CPT-EXC-GW, TPHg, and TPHd were detected <br /> at 3,500 and 1,100 micrograms per liter (gg/L) respectively MTBE and benzene were not <br /> detected above laboratory reporting limits Toluene, ethylbenzene and xylenes were detected <br /> at 9 0 µg/L, 74 pg/L and 290 gg/L respectively <br /> Tables 1 and 2 show the analytical results for the soil and groundwater confirmation samples, <br /> respectively Appendix B presents the analytical laboratory reports <br /> 4.6 Soil Stockpile Sampling and Disposal <br /> ' Soil from the excavation was placed into two stockpiles according to excavation depth Soil <br /> from the top fifteen feet of the excavation(shallow stockpile)was separated from soil from the <br /> ' bottom ten feet of the excavation (deep stockpile) Eight discrete soil samples were collected <br /> from the deep stockpile on 20 April 2005 Each discrete sample represented approximately 18 to <br /> ' 20 cubic yards of soil (Table 4) All samples from the soil stockpile were analyzed for TPHg, <br /> BTEX, and MTBE Table 4 presents the analytical results for the stockpile samples for TPHg, <br /> ' BTEX, and MTBE Samples CPTSP-C and CPTSP-F were composited and analyzed for CAM <br /> 17 metals for landfill disposal characterization purposes MTBE and benzene were not detected <br /> above laboratory reporting limits in any of the soil stockpile samples Toluene, ethylbenzene, <br /> 25971024 DGD 7 7 June 2005 <br />
